Step 1
Blend smoothie ingredients until smooth. If you want it nice and thick, use a blender with a tamper so you can move it around. If you like it a little thinner, you might need a little bit more liquid.
Step 2
Add your smoothie to a bowl and top with your favorite fresh fruit, granola, and a drizzle of nut butter.
